Abeche, Chad: International Volunteer Day (IVD) was celebrated in Abeche, Eastern Chad with fervour and enthusiasm. Since the inception of the UNV programme in Chad, this was the first opportunity for IVD celebrations to take place in Abeche instead of N’Djamena, the capital city. Read
